            Bug ID: 93619
           Summary: UI: repeatedly expanding line->width in properties
                    sidebar crashes LibO

To reproduce:

1) open a drawing
2) assure that the properties side panel is open
3) select a line (draw it beforehand as needed)
4) click on the little down arrow on the side of the line width properties in
the properties sidebar, to open the line width selection dropdown menu
5) close the dropdown (e.g. by pressing esc)
6) redo from 4)

See libreoffice freezing while a log is created.
